Overview:

To provide representative payee services to adult Social Security (SSA/SSI) beneficiaries living with severe and persistent mental illness and/or co-occurring developmental disabilities. Representative payee caseloads range from 70-75 beneficiaries (i.e, clients).

Duties/Responsibilities:

* Determine a client's basic monthly needs and how best to address them base on their income and abilities to self-budget.

* Assist clients with developing a budget and counsel clients on ways to stay within the budget.

* Meet individually with clients to determine weekly/monthly spending requests, discuss changes in bills, assist with utility hook-ups, etc.

* Closely monitor all assigned cases and maintain appropriate, accurate electronic and paper records of deposits, payments, and other transactions.

* Coordinate with others (such as county case managers, housing staff, counselors, etc.) who are assisting the client on issues related to client finances or client behavior related to finances.

* Collaborate with county case managers and work to promote the Representative Payee Program county-wide.

* Utilize the phone to exchange information and do problem solving with clients and behavioral health providers. Return phone calls promptly.

* Utilize de-escalation skills and techniques with clients who are angry or threatening (training will be provided).

* Provide timely notification to Social Security Administration if a client experiences any changes in circumstances, such as address change, change in employment, etc.

* Provide, as needed, a client's transaction history from RPM (Representative Payee Manager) software.

* Maintain strict confidentiality concerning both program applicants and accepted clients while carrying out all duties.

* Complete the annual Representative Payee Report for each client, listing client funds received and funds spent.

* Participate in Social Security audits of representative payee activities/services.

* Maintain a courteous and professional tone and manner with clients and providers in all communications.

*Participate actively in on-going professional growth and development; maintain professional behavior and participate in supervisory meetings.

* Perform other duties as assigned.
